Patent number: 8207705Abstract: The present invention provides a charging apparatus capable of efficiently charging battery in view of power consumption and a charging method. The charging apparatus has a charging unit which charges a battery, a remaining capacity detecting unit which detects remaining capacity of the battery, a necessary charging capacity obtaining unit which obtains charging capacity necessary for use after completion of the charging of the battery, an additional charging capacity calculating unit which calculates additional charging capacity for additionally charging the battery based on the remaining capacity and the necessary charging capacity of the battery, a charging current determining unit which determines a charging current at the time when the charging unit charges for the additional charging capacity based on power consumption generated at the time of charging for the additional charging capacity, and a control unit which controls the charging unit based on the determined charging current.Type: GrantFiled: July 2, 2009Date of Patent: June 26, 2012Assignee: Sony CorporationInventors: Osamu Nagashima, Kei Tashiro, Yoichi Miyajima, Toshio Takeshita

Publication number: 20110287306Abstract: In a battery loading and unloading mechanism, a battery formed in a flat rectangular parallelepiped and having an almost square main surface is loaded and unloaded to and from a device. The battery is formed with projecting portions at longitudinal both ends of a back surface thereof and along the back surface, whereby the battery can be prevented from being erroneously inserted into the device. The projecting portion has an inclined surface acutely inclined with respect to the back surface, and when the battery is unloaded from the device, unloading of the battery from the device is accelerated by the inclined surface undergoing contact pressure of the retaining means. The device is formed with a notched portion which is adapted to expose the other projecting portion of the battery when the battery is loaded, thereby facilitating unloading of the battery.Type: ApplicationFiled: May 26, 2011Publication date: November 24, 2011Inventors: Takayoshi Yamasaki, Hiroaki Sato, Toshiaki Ueda, Tomonori Watanabe, Yoichi Miyajima, Osamu Nagashima, Mieko Hara

Publication number: 20110163726Abstract: A battery pack includes a battery cell, a charge calculator that calculates an amount of charge of the battery cell, a charge setting that sets multiple amounts of charge with different upper limits, a charge selecting switch that selects one of the amounts of charge, and a battery controller having a communication function that sends, to the charging apparatus, charge information about the battery cell and charging command information that instructs charging to be continued to an upper limit for the selected amount of charge.Type: ApplicationFiled: December 23, 2010Publication date: July 7, 2011Applicant: Sony CorporationInventors: Osamu Nagashima, Yoichi Miyajima, Shoichi Shintani, Jiro Moriya
